About Ankit Kumar

Ankit Kumar is a scholar working on Materials Chemistry, Mechanics of Materials, General Materials Science, Mechanical Engineering and Bioengineering, having authored 36 papers that have together received 690 indexed citations. Recurring topics across this work include Metal and Thin Film Mechanics (11 papers), Diamond and Carbon-based Materials Research (8 papers), Advanced materials and composites (6 papers), Boron and Carbon Nanomaterials Research (5 papers), Corrosion Behavior and Inhibition (5 papers), Graphene research and applications (5 papers), Pickering emulsions and particle stabilization (4 papers) and Surfactants and Colloidal Systems (3 papers). The work is most often cited by research in Materials Chemistry (477 citations), Organic Chemistry (166 citations), Mechanics of Materials (140 citations), Ceramics and Composites (30 citations) and Food Science (93 citations). Ankit Kumar has collaborated with scholars based in India, United States and South Korea. Frequent co-authors include Daeyeon Lee, Rahul S. Mulik, Bum Jun Park, Fuquan Tu, Gaurav Malik, Ramesh Chandra, Gurminder Singh, Shigeng Li, Chieh‐Min Cheng and Siddharth Sharma. Their work appears in journals such as Ceramics International, Journal of Materials Engineering and Performance, Surface and Coatings Technology, Chemistry - A European Journal and Journal of Colloid and Interface Science.
